A quality car seat will have extra features that go beyond the federal safety standards. These include padded inserts for the head and shoulders as well as air-repellent fabric to help keep them cool in hot vehicles and side-impact safety.

Another crucial safety aspect is how easy it is to set up and use the seat. Ideally, you should be capable of snapping it in place with little effort, and with clear signs that it's secure and level, as well as positioned correctly.

Look for features that allow you to do this, such as built-in lock offs and belt guides that can help you align the car seat with the seat belt. You also want to avoid buying used car seats, as they might not have been tested for crash safety or have been involved in an accident, and could not protect your child. If you do decide to purchase an old one be sure that it's on the expiration date and isn't being sold by an individual seller who doesn't have proof of ownership.

Easy to Use

It is crucial that a car seat be easy to install and use, particularly if it will be used in different vehicles at times. Look for features like a quick-release buckle, an indicator that displays the state of the latch system (e.g., green for locked) and a clear, easy-to-read guide to make it as stress-free as you can.

Design

The styles of car seats are as varied as the vehicles they're installed in. Some parents opt to not use an infant car seat and opt for a convertible model. However, the majority of new mothers want something that can grow with their child into toddlerhood. The most versatile choice is an all-in-one infant car seat, which allows you to switch between rear-facing and forward-facing. It typically has a greater height and weight limit, and it can be used as a booster seat if your child is old enough to need one.
